The Tax Administration Branch within the Taxation Division in the Department of Finance administers taxation legislation through information, compliance, audit and enforcement programs on behalf of the government of Manitoba. The Branch is seeking an innovative and highly motivated individual to join its team as a Senior Refund Administrator.

Duties:

Reporting to the Refund Supervisor, the incumbent is responsible for verifying and processing refund applications under the tax statutes administered by the Taxation Division. The incumbent is responsible for the most complex and sensitive refund applications analysing applications that require senior delegation and financial authority.
